Problem

Existing poster creation methods fail to consider the user's intended impression, focusing solely on template differences without ensuring the final poster reflects the desired aesthetic or emotional impact.

Innovation Solution

An information processing apparatus and method that allows users to specify a target impression, using a processor to create posters by selecting templates, images, and layouts that align with the intended aesthetic, incorporating features like color schemes and fonts to achieve the desired impression.

Data Source

PatentUS12412327B2Information processing apparatus, control method therefor, and storage medium
Publication Date: 2025.09.09 CANON KK

AI summary

An information processing apparatus includes at least one processor, and a memory that stores a program which, when executed by the at least one processor, causes the at least one processor to function as an acceptance unit configured to accept from a user a target impression of a poster image to be created, and a creation unit configured to create the poster image based on the target impression.
